What Are Some Ways To Improve The Taste Of My Dog’s Food?

One way of adding flavor to kibble is by moistening it with low-salt chicken broth or vegetable stock before serving it. Alternatively try mixing wet and dry foods together- either canned meat & veggies with dried out kibble pieces so long as both types of food meet nutritional requirements for the breed.

Top 5 Facts For Enhancing Your Dog’s Food Flavor

As a dog parent, you know that your furry friend deserves the best when it comes to their nutrition. However, even with high-quality food options, some dogs can become picky eaters and lose interest in their meals. That’s why enhancing your dog’s food flavor has become an important topic among pet parents. Here are the top 5 facts for improving your dog‘s mealtime experience:

1) Add Variety
Just like humans, dogs enjoy diversity in their diets too! Rotate different types of protein sources such as chicken, beef or fish so they don’t get bored with the same flavors every day. For added variety toss in green leafy vegetables like spinach or kale into their feeding routine which will add texture without changing much of what is already being fed.

2) Try Broth or Gravy Toppers
Broth or gravy toppers can make any dry kibble more enticing by adding moisture and extra taste while still maintaining balanced nutrition levels. Plus this easy-to-use option can be stored easily and used whenever needed.

3) Incorporate Supplements
Did you know supplements can do wonders for your dog’s digestive system? Adding Omega-3 fatty acids helps support skin and coat health while probiotics improve digestion issues thereby improving overall appetite wellness in our puppies.

4) Use Cooked Meats (In Moderation)
While raw meat may not agree with some pets’ tummies since it contains bacteria that shouldn’t be ingested excessively; boiled or cooked meats once cooled down properly makes for great natural additive options – just check that there aren’t any additional seasonings especially if using leftovers from human foods.

Creative Twists on Traditional Dog Recipes for Extra Flavor

As dog owners, we always want the best for our furry friends. We spend time researching different foods to feed them, trying to find the perfect balance of nutrition and flavor. However, sometimes it’s fun to mix things up with creative twists on traditional dog recipes.

One way to add extra flavor is by incorporating herbs into your dog’s meals. Some great options include parsley, basil, oregano, and thyme. Not only do these herbs provide a burst of fresh flavors, but they also offer numerous health benefits for your pup.

Another delicious addition is bone broth. This nutrient-rich liquid not only adds depth and richness to dishes but can also aid in gut health and inflammation reduction. It’s easy enough to make at home- just simmer bones (chicken or beef) with water and veggies like carrots or celery until a rich stock forms.

For those wanting something quick & simple: Try topping dry kibble with warm chicken soup before serving … guaranteed tail wagger!

Information from an expert: As a veterinarian and animal nutritionist, I would suggest trying different types of protein sources for your dog’s food. For example, switch from chicken to beef or fish to lamb. You can also add natural flavor enhancers such as bone broth or canned pumpkin to give the food a richer taste. Lastly, consider adding fresh fruits and vegetables into their diet which are not only tasty but also provide essential nutrients. Just be sure to introduce any changes gradually over several days to avoid digestive upset.
